However, you must be killed by the guards for this to work. You are simply knocked out and you get back up after a few moments. The best part about this location is that if the guards "kill" you, you don't die but you lose money (Hooray for save points). Due to the high level of the guards, you may just be able to do one guard before you die. Do the following in order: use Devil's Puffball, shoot the Broadhead Bolt, use Igni/Dancing Star. Once they begin to engage, lock onto one of them. Simply pull out your sword and do a few slashes to provoke them. There are usually two guards standing at the end of the bridge near the signpost. It is directly to the left on the signpost labeled Novigrad Gate. Location - I recommend the bridge outside of Oxenfurt. You can use regular Igni for this as well but its burning effect rate is fairly low so keep that in mind if going down that path. If you aren't a high enough level to get these abilities then use the Dancing Star Bomb instead. This will allow you to use Adrenaline Points for Signs and have an Adrenaline Point at the beginning of combat. Also get the Abilities Rage Management (General Branch) and Razor Focus (Combat Branch/Battle Trance Tree). Acquire Level 5 of the Ability Pyromaniac (last Ability of the Igni Sign) which gives 100% Burning effect to all Igni cast. Burning - Use a potion of clearance to free up your ability points. I recommend the Enhanced or Superior versions since the effect lasts for 30 sec but the Regular (10 sec) version work as well. Poisoning - Obtain and craft the Devil's Puffball. They apply the bleeding effect on hit for 15 sec. Bleeding - Buy Broadhead Bolts from the Blacksmith in Oxenfurt. Before anything else, make a save point you can load back to. There are multiple ways of applying the three effects.
